IBM Support

PH56776: Q capture terminated with ASN0678E though TERM=N

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• The Capture program gets SIGSEGV or terminates with ASN0678E
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: 1- Any client using TERM=N with asnqcap or   *
    *                 asnqapp                                      *
    *                 2- All SQL Apply users                       *
    ****************************************************************
    * PROBLEM DESCRIPTION: 1- The Capture program gets SIGSEGV or  *
    *                      terminates with ASN0678E                *
    *                      2- SQL Apply TRUNCATE failed SQLCODE    *
    *                      -428                                    *
    ****************************************************************
    1- With TERM=N, depending on the time where Db2 or MQ down is
    detected, the program threads may not be terminated gracefully
    leading to threads being killed and un-initialized memory
    accessed.
    2- Currently, when performing a fullrefresh, the APPLY program
    will execute the TRUNCATE command
    

Problem conclusion

  • 1- MQ and Db2 being stopped or quiesced is detected, the
    threads terminate gracefully, and the program waits for them to
    restart instead of coming down.
    2- Apply should retry the TRUNCATE operation with a COMMIT
    before DELETE. If Apply still fails -428, then Apply should
    retry using DELETE.
    ASNCLP was not updated.
    Function Level: 1140.103
    

Temporary fix

Comments

APAR Information

  • APAR number

    PH56776

  • Reported component name

    WS REPLICATION

  • Reported component ID

    5655L8800

  • Reported release

    B33

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2023-09-06

  • Closed date

    2023-10-19

  • Last modified date

    2023-11-01

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I94083 UI94084 UI94085 UI94086

Modules/Macros

  • ASN2BASE ASN2DB2Q ASN2DBCN ASN2SQLZ ASN2ZOSC ASNAAPP  ASNACMD
    ASNADMSP ASNAPPLY ASNCAP   ASNCATM  ASNCCMD  ASNCCPWK ASNCDINS
    ASNDB2SQ ASNDBCON ASNMCMD  ASNMON   ASNPRUNE ASNQACMD ASNQAHKT
    ASNQAPAG ASNQAPP  ASNQAROW ASNQASUB ASNQBRWZ ASNQCAP  ASNQCCMD
    ASNQDEP  ASNQEXRP ASNQLODZ ASNQMFMT ASNQP2PA ASNQP2PI ASNQSPIL
    ASNQSQLZ ASNQXFMT ASNRBASE ASNSQLCZ ASNTDIFF ASNTDSP  ASNTRC
    ASNUOW   ASNZOSCN
    

Fix information

  • Fixed component name

    WS REPLICATION

  • Fixed component ID

    5655L8800

Applicable component levels

  • RB33 PSY UI94083

       UP23/10/21 P F310

  • RB34 PSY UI94084

       UP23/10/24 P F310

  • RB35 PSY UI94085

       UP23/10/24 P F310

  • RB36 PSY UI94086

       UP23/10/21 P F310

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U029","label":"Software"},"Product":{"code":"SSDP5R","label":"InfoSphere Replication Server"},"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"B33"}]

Document Information

Modified date:
02 November 2023